The ionization potential for second He electron is
13.6 eV
27.2 eV
54.4 eV
100 eV
For the ionization of second He electron. He+ will act as hydrogen like atom. Hence ionization potential
$=Z^2 \times 13.6$ volt $=(2)^2 \times 13.6=54.4 V$
